Choosing Quality Ingredients

Cheese Selection and Texture

The three cheese combination defines the character of this lasagna. Full flavor starts with choosing cheeses that melt smoothly and hold structure.

Mozzarella provides stretch, Parmesan adds salty depth, and Ricotta contributes a soft, creamy contrast.

Pasta and Sauce Essentials

No-boil lasagna sheets keep preparation quick, while a rich tomato sauce carries the flavors between layers. Opt for high-quality canned tomatoes or a well-seasoned passata for a vibrant base.

Step by Step Baking Process

Follow a logical sequence to build neat layers that cook evenly. Start with a thin sauce base, add a sheet of pasta, then a mixture of cheeses, and repeat.

Finish with extra Parmesan on top to create a golden crust that lightly crisps under the broiler for an appealing finish.

Timing and Temperature Guide

Oven temperature and resting time are critical for structure and sliceability. Bake until the edges bubble and the surface turns golden, then pause before cutting.

Resting allows the layers to set, making each portion hold its shape for a cleaner presentation and easier serving.

Customization and Variations

Adding Protein and Vegetables

You can enhance the easy three cheese lasagna with optional ingredients. Ground beef, Italian sausage, or sautéed spinach integrate smoothly without complicating the workflow.

Gluten Free and Lighter Options

For a gluten-free version, use certified gluten-free pasta or thinly sliced roasted vegetables. Lower-fat Ricotta and reduced cheese quantities can cut calories while keeping creaminess.

FAQ

Reader questions

Can I use fresh pasta sheets instead of no-boil?

Yes, fresh pasta sheets work well if you precook them briefly and dry excess moisture to prevent a soggy bake.

How do I prevent the cheese from becoming greasy?

Balance high-moisture cheeses with low-moisture Mozzarella and avoid overloading each layer with oil or heavy cream.

Can I assemble this lasagna ahead and refrigerate?

You can assemble ahead, cover tightly, and chill for up to 24 hours before baking; add a few extra minutes to the bake time if started from cold.

What is the best way to reheat leftovers?

Reheat individual portions in the microwave with a splash of water or in a low oven to refresh the texture without drying out the cheese.
